Bridge33 Capital is a rapidly growing, vertically integrated real estate private equity firm focused on open-air retail real estate.

The Company recently raised $458 MM in its latest opportunistic fund, marking a key milestone for the company.

We are seeking a SENIOR FINANCIAL ANALYST who is responsible for asset cashflow modeling and financial reporting . This position requires a deep understanding of real estate finance, excellent analytical skills, and the ability to communicate complex financial concepts clearly.

The successful candidate will succeed by providing accurate financial models and comprehensive reports that drive strategic decision-making and fund level performance reporting .

This is an in-person role based in our Seattle office.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ES

Asset Cash Flow Modeling :

  • Develop, maintain, and update detailed cash flow models for various real estate assets.
  • Analyze financial performance and projections to support investment decisions.
  • Assess the financial impact of potential acquisitions, dispositions, and capital projects.
  • Conduct sensitivity and scenario analysis to evaluate risks and opportunities.

Financial Reporting :

  • Prepare and present regular financial reports, including income statements, balance sheets, and cash flow statements.
  • Ensure accuracy and completeness of financial data for internal and external reporting.
  • Collaborate with Accounting and Asset Management teams to reconcile discrepancies and ensure full understanding of the asset and business plan.

Collaboration and Communication :

  • Work closely with Asset management, acquisitions, and accounting teams to gather and analyze relevant data.
  • Communicate findings and recommendations clearly and effectively to stakeholders.
  • Support the development and implementation of financial processes and systems to improve efficiency and accuracy.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, Accounting, Real Estate, or a related field; CFA preferred.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in financial analysis, preferably within the real estate or private equity industry.
  • Strong proficiency in financial modeling and advanced Excel skills.
  • Experience with financial reporting and accounting principles.
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ills.
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Effective communication and presentation skills.
  • Knowledge of real estate markets and investment strategies.
  • Familiarity with financial software and tools (e.g., Argus, Yardi, MRI) is a plus.
